加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0743zz.cn/)- 科技、图像技术、AI硬件、数据采集、智能营销!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L JSON数据类型解析与多场景应用探索

发布时间:2025-10-18 09:55:06 所属栏目:MySql教程 来源:DaWei
导读: MySQL从5.7版本开始引入了JSON数据类型,这一特性极大地增强了数据库对非结构化数据的处理能力。JSON类型允许在表中存储和查询结构化的键值对数据,使得开发者可以在单个字段中保存复杂

MySQL从5.7版本开始引入了JSON数据类型,这一特性极大地增强了数据库对非结构化数据的处理能力。JSON类型允许在表中存储和查询结构化的键值对数据,使得开发者可以在单个字段中保存复杂的数据结构。


使用JSON数据类型时,可以通过内置的函数如JSON_EXTRACT、JSON_SET等来操作存储在JSON字段中的数据。这些函数提供了类似编程语言中对象属性访问的方式,让SQL查询更加灵活和直观。


2025AI效果图,仅供参考

在实际应用中,JSON数据类型常用于需要动态扩展数据结构的场景。例如,在用户配置信息中,不同的用户可能有不同的设置项,使用JSON可以避免频繁修改表结构,提高系统的可维护性。


另一方面,JSON数据类型也适用于日志记录、元数据存储以及多语言内容管理等场景。它能够有效支持多种数据格式的存储,并且通过索引优化,可以提升查询效率。


尽管JSON数据类型带来了便利,但也需要注意其局限性。比如,对于大规模数据的频繁更新或复杂查询,可能会导致性能下降。因此,在设计数据库时需要根据具体需求权衡使用。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章